  5. Hi Brell,

     

    Prior to this years World Cruise only the Captain's Collection and Commodore's Wine Collection were available for purchase before boarding the QM2. We purchased these by phoning Southampton as instructed on the Voyage personaliser.

     

    The vouchers for the number of bottles ordered were presented to us by our Sommelier on the first evening but after a couple of days they announced a 'World Cruise Wine Collection' which could only be purchased on-board ship. The World Cruise Collection gave us a choice from a larger list of wines. After discussion we were allowed to choose our bottle from either collection as we pleased.

     

    AFAIK the World Cruise Collection is only available when on the World Cruise.

  14. I have just received the following information from our TA regarding the cancellation of Egyptian calls.

     

    Due to security concerns in Safaga and Sharm el Sheikh, Cunard have decided to replace these ports of call with visits to Oman’s capital, Muscat and the beautiful city of Limassol, situated on the southern coast of Cyprus.

     

    In order to accommodate these changes, it has been necessary for us to amend the date of the call in to Aqaba. The revised section of the itinerary is now as follows:-

     

    20/04/17 Muscat, Oman – Arrive early morning & Depart afternoon

    21/04/17 At sea for 4 Days

    25/04/17 Aqaba, Jordan – Arrive morning & Depart evening

    26/04/17 At sea

    27/04/17 Suez, Egypt - Arrive early morning, Cruise by, Depart early morning

    Suez Canal – Arrive early morning, Cruise by, Depart afternoon

    Port Said, Egypt – Arrive early evening, Cruise by, Depart early evening

    28/04/17 Limassol, Cyprus – Arrive early morning, Depart early evening

     

     

    I have heard good reports from friends who have visited Muscat and of course Cyprus is always worth a visit.

    You should be in luck according to Ask Cunard https://ask.cunard.com/help/cunard/fleet/refit_schedule

     

     

     

    Queen Mary 2 will be refurbishing the following grades during dry dock:

    All Grills Suites

    All Britannia Club balconies on Deck 12

    All Britannia Balconies on Deck 12, Deck 11 and Deck 8

    All Britannia Obstructed Balconies on Deck 8

    BU/BV Grades of Britannia Sheltered balconies on Deck 6

     

     

     

    Queen Mary 2 will be refurbishing the following staterooms in service before her 2017 World Voyage:

    Remaining BZ/BY Grades of Britannia Sheltered Balconies on Deck 6

    All Britannia sheltered balconies on Deck 4 and Deck 5

    All Britannia Ocean Views

    All Britannia Atrium Views

    All Britannia Insides
